Сколько основных конструкций используется в информационной модели предметной области?
(Отметьте один правильный вариант ответа.)
Варианты ответа
12
9
7
6(Верный ответ)
Элементы модели | Определение | ||
---|---|---|---|
1 | Сущность предметной области | A | - это атрибут сущности, позволяющий отличать одну сущность от другой. |
2 | Атрибут сущности | B | - это атрибут конкретного экземпляра сущности, у которого может быть только одно значение. |
3 | Экземпляры сущности | C | - это атрибут конкретного экземпляра сущности, у которого может быть несколько значений. |
4 | Уникальный идентификатор сущности | D | - это класс объектов или явлений предметной области базы данных. |
5 | Однозначный атрибут | E | - это выражение, которое определяет значения, разрешенные для данного атрибута; область значений атрибута |
6 | Многозначный атрибут | F | - это реализации сущности, отличающиеся друг от друга и допускающие однозначную идентификацию |
7 | Домен атрибута | G | - это свойство или характеристика сущности |
Этап | Содержание | ||
---|---|---|---|
1. | Создание логической модели базы данных | A | - это этап, на котором на основании информационной модели предметной области базы данных создается логическая структура базы данных, независимая от ее реализации |
2. | Создание физической модели базы данных: внутренняя схема | B | - это этап, на котором анализируются возможные транзакции системы, выполняется, в случае необходимости, денормализация отношений для обеспечения более высокой производительности базы данных |
3. | Создание физической модели базы данных: учет влияния транзакций | C | - это этап, на котором на основании логической модели базы данных создается физическая структура базы данных, зависимая от ее реализации |
4. | Создание серверного кода | D | - это этап, на котором на основании функциональной модели предметной области базы данных создается серверный код базы данных в виде триггеров, хранимых процедур и пакетов |
5. | Проектирование модулей приложений базы данных | E | - это этап, на котором создаются спецификации модулей приложений, разрабатываются стратегии тестирования базы данных и приложений, создается план тестирования приложений базы данных и готовятся тестовые данные |
6. | Контроль качества проектирования базы данных | F | заключается в настройке некоторых транзакций к базе данных и локальном перепроектировании базы данных согласно требованиям, поступающим с других этапов создания базы данных |
7. | Учет задач обратного влияния | G | заключается в проверке качества результатов проектирования на каждом его этапе |
8. | Сбор и анализ входных данных | H | - это начальный этап проектирования, на котором осуществляется сбор и контроль качества результатов анализа предметной области базы данных, готовится план проектирования базы данных |
Понятие | Определение | ||
---|---|---|---|
1 | Ядро предметной области | A | в каждый конкретный момент времени представляет собой выделенную совокупность определенных объектов и ситуаций |
2 | Объект | B | - взаимосвязи, выражающие взаимоотношения между объектами |
3 | Класс ситуаций | C | является результатом абстрагирования реального объекта путем выделения и фиксации набора его свойств |
4 | Состояние предметной области (снимок) | D | - совокупность объектов (реалий внешнего мира), о которых можно задавать вопросы |
Задачи | Результаты | ||
---|---|---|---|
1. | Контроль качества ER-диаграмм | A | Последовательность работ бизнес-модели процесса проектирования базы данных со сведениями об ответственных исполнителях и сроках их исполнения |
2. | Контроль качества диаграмм функциональной модели предметной области базы данных | B | Основа для создания логической модели базы данных |
3. | Систематизация требований заказчика к базе данных | C | Вывод о достаточности требований и реализуемости базы данных |
4. | Подготовка плана проектирования базы данных | D | Основа для разработки серверного кода и проектирования модулей приложений базы данных |
Элемент | Определение | ||
---|---|---|---|
1. | Имя транзакции и номер транзакции | A | уникальная идентификация каждой транзакции базы данных |
2. | Описание транзакции | Б | онлайновая транзакция или пакетная транзакция, высокая, средняя, низкая |
3. | Характер транзакции и ее сложность | В | перечень операций предметной области, которые выполняются транзакцией |
4. | Объем транзакции | Г | средняя частота и пиковая частота использования |
5. | Требования к производительности транзакции | Д | количество секунд, необходимое для завершения транзакции в режиме эксплуатации базы данных. |
6. | Относительный приоритет | Е | насколько важна настоящая транзакция для предметной области по сравнению с другими |
7. | Время выполнения транзакции | Ж | количества секунд, требуемых для выполнения транзакции |